Lanesboro, MN- A motorcycle accident occurred in Fillmore County early on Sunday morning, and the State Patrol arrived to the scene.
On Highway 16, approximately three miles south of Lanesboro, the event took place just before 11:20 in the morning, according to the preliminary report on the occurrence. According to the State Patrol, the motorcyclist was heading in a northerly direction at the time of the collision.
An investigation revealed that the motorcyclist was Kimberly Ann Karg, who was 44 years old and from Hutchinson. The Lanesboro Ambulance took her to St. Mary’s Hospital in Rochester, where she was treated for injuries that were not considered to be life-threatening.
According to the State Patrol, she was not wearing a helmet at the time on the scene.
